THE HOME RULE BILL
DEBATE IN COMMITTEE. By Cable —Press Association—Copyright. Received 4, 10.30 p.m. London, July 4. In the House of Commons the first clause of the Home Rule Bill was adopted bv 310 to 224. Mr. Asquith, moving the closure, led to vigorous protests and a heated scene between Captain Craig and Mr. Whitely (Chairman of Committees).
